What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Prague to Budapest?

The average price of all flights from Prague to Budapest cl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Budapest on a Tues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Thursday is the most expensive day to fly from Prague to Budapest.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Saturday and avoiding Fridays for the best de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Prague to Budapest?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Prague to Budapest,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Prague to Budapest is October, where tickets cost $75 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are November and December, where the average cost of tickets is $193 and $172 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Prague to Budapest?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Prague to Budapest,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Prague to Budapest,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 62 days before departure.

How many flights are there between Prague and Budapest per day?

Each day, there are between 1 and 5 nonstop flights that take off from Prague and land in Budapest, with an average flight time of 1h 19m. The most common departure time is 6:00 am and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 20 flights. The most frequent day of departure is Tuesday, when 25% of all weekly flights depart. The fewest flights depart on a Saturday.

FAQs for booking flights from Prague to Budapest

  • From which terminal should you get your flight?

    Since Budapest, Hungary, is in the Schengen area, you'll fly from Terminal 2. You can pay for the Fast Track program to speed you through security. Book in advance for about 150 CZK ($7) per person.

  • What travel options are available from BUD Airport to downtown Budapest?

    You have two travel options from BUD Airport to Budapest city center, which are taxi and bus. Taxi booths are located at the exits of Terminals 2A and 2B. Bus 100E departs from the BKK stop at the arrivals level between both terminals. Get your ticket from the ticket vending machines in the Arrivals Hall.

  • Are there on-site hotels in BUD Airport?

    If you arrive late in Budapest and would like to spend the night at Budapest Airport, the Ibis Styles Budapest Airport Hotel is within walking distance, opposite Terminal 2.

  • What services are available at BUD Airport?

    There are spa and salon services at Lian Day Spa in Terminal 2 and DryBar in SkyCourt. The Terrace Cafe Rooftop at Terminal 2 has a smoking area, Terminal 2B has a chapel, and Terminal 2A has an observation deck that charges about 500 HUF (1.66 USD).

Top tips for finding a cheap flight from PRG to Budapest

  • Looking for a cheap flight? 25% of our users found flights on this route for $33 or less one-way and $78 or less round-trip.
  • Vaclav Havel Airport Prague (PRG) is about 6 miles away from downtown Prague. A fast and convenient way to get there would be to use the AE Express bus that takes about 30min to the airport, depending on traffic. The bus departs from the main station, Praha Hlavni Nadrazi, and stops at both Terminals 1 and 2.
  • Liszt Ferenc International Airport (BUD) is situated about 12 miles away from central Budapest. Some of the airlines you can book your flight with include RyanAir, Austrian Air, Lufthansa, SWISS AIR, LOT, Air France, easyJet, and KLM. You can fly nonstop with RyanAir.
  • Prague Airport is a hub for Smartwings Airlines and Czech Airlines and a base for Ryanair. Budapest Airport is a hub for Wizz Air and Smartwings and also a base for Ryanair.
  • PRG Airport has several hotel options, starting with a Rest and Fun Center inside the transit area of Terminal 1. You must be flying from Terminal 1 or be in transit to use it. The Ramada Airport Hotel is located in Terminal 3, and free shuttles are available from Terminals 1 and 2. The Courtyard Prague Airport Hotel is located between Terminals 1 and 2.
  • If you're traveling through PRG airport with kids, there are baby care facilities in Terminal 1 and 2. You'll also find strollers throughout the transit area and two Children's Corners in Terminals 1 and 2 with climbers, slides, and toys. Additionally, there are more mini play areas in both terminals, mechanical riding toys throughout the airport, a Bambule toy shop in Terminal 2, and board games in the Terminal 2 Departure Hall.
  • Prague Airport has a medical center and a pharmacy located in the connecting Corridor between Terminals 1 and 2. There's an interfaith chapel in Terminal 1 airside and a rest area, Kooperative Relaxation Zone in Terminal 2. You can shower at the Rest & Fun Center for about 99 CZK ($5) in Terminal 1. It's free at Pier D in Terminal 2, but you can pay about $11 for a towel and key.
  • If you have some time on your hands, PRG Airport has a museum in Terminal 2. You can watch documentaries and view maps and photographs. There are two observation decks in both Terminals and reading corners with local and foreign language books in Terminal 1.
